Territory and style of the wine

The Cuvée 747 comes from grapes harvested in the municipalities of Aÿ, Dizy, Hautvillers, and Champillon, as well as Avize and Oiry, with a predominance of Pinot due to the climatic conditions of the 2019 vintage. The stylistic profile reflects a balanced and high-quality harvest, with wines described as structured, dense, and complex. The choice to work with reserve wines and a very low dosage, equal to 1.5 g/l, helps define a Champagne Extra-Brut that is dry, clear, and of great precision. Aging in wooden barrels on the lees, without filtration or clarification, adds depth and a sensation of well-integrated substance.

Tasting notes

In the glass, the Champagne Cuvée 747 Extra-Brut Jacquesson shows a taut and complex style, with significant structure always supported by freshness and balance. On the nose, the aromatic register is fine and articulated, with scents that may recall ripe fruit, floral notes, and more evolved nuances from aging. On the palate, it is dry, precise, and of good density, with an elegant bubble and a persistent finish, consistent with a great Champagne for connoisseurs.

Recommended pairings

Thanks to its Extra-Brut profile and structure, the Champagne Cuvée 747 Extra-Brut Jacquesson pairs with great versatility with raw seafood, fish tartare, oysters, shellfish, sushi, and dishes based on white fish. It is also suitable for richer preparations such as white meats, poultry, aged cheeses that are not overly salty, and refined seafood cuisine. The Magnum format makes it particularly interesting for important dinners, toasts, and shared tastings.

Serving temperature

To best appreciate the Champagne Cuvée 747 Extra-Brut Jacquesson, a serving temperature between 8 and 10 °C is recommended. This way, freshness, finesse, and aromatic complexity are enhanced without compromising the structure. If served in Magnum, it can benefit from a few minutes of waiting in the glass to progressively open up.
